– How to Listen and Compare in Real Time Different Codecs via Master Check Pro

– i.e. How the Music Sounds in Streaming and / or as Download Version 

– Master Check Pro Supports All the Music Platforms

– Detects True Peaks

– Meter = will Meter the DAW Playback Source (i.e. Channel you have Send Plugin Routed to Master Check)

– Icon = Listen to the Difference that is Being Removed when Encoding in Monitor Mode (i.e. Difference Codec vs the Original Source Material

– Monitor Mode = Audition the Codecs

Example Master for iTunes Streaming

1) Insert Master Check Pro in the Main Mix Output

2) Play Back your Material and Let Mastercheck Analyze the Source Material Signal (Shows the LKFS Readout)

– Be Sure to Let the Source Material Play for Enough Time for an Accurate Integrated Loudness Reading

3) Choose your Appropriate Target Codec Manually or via Preset here

– you See the Target´s LKFS which is here at -16 for iTunes Streaming (Be Sure “External Ref” is OFF)

4) Play Back the Material Again and Click “Offset to Match” 

– Mastercheck Fits the Volume of your Track to the -16 LKFS for iTunes Streaming (also Shows How Much Gain it has Applied which is here 15.4 LU)

5) Insert a TP Limiter on your Track and Increase the Gain by the Required LU (this Example +15.4 LU)

6) Now that the Integrated Level Matches the Target, Go to the “Monitor” Option to Finally Listen to Codec Versions (Be Sure that “Offset to Match” is OFF)

7) It is Simply  a Matter of Pressing the Round Square to Listen to the Codec 

– Keep an Eye on the Peak Meters and Eventually Go Back to the Limiter Unit and Activate the True Peak Limiter Function (here -4.4LU is a Safe Headroom)

– Press “Icon” to Listen to the Difference that is Being Removed when Encoding, the Heavier the Encoding the More Signal you will Hear (e.g. in 40 kbps Encoding More Material will be Removed than in 256kbps)

8) Once Levels, Peaks etc are Matched you Know What to Do to Optimise / Master your Material and Enhance the Result Before Print the Codec Version 

Compare to an External Reference Source

1) Insert Nugen Send on Desired Reference Track

– Only Enable “Audio Thru” in the Send Instance to Hear the Source Constantly (which is NOT Necessary here)

2) Select the “Send” Instance Inside the Master Check Pro Instance in the Main Mix Output to Make the Connection

3) Activate “External Ref” 

4) Same as Before, Click “Offset to Match” will Match your Track to the Reference Track

– Notice that the “Icon” here Shows the Difference in Level, i.e. Left Your Material (here -21.4 LU) and Right Reference Material (here -33.7 LU)

5) To Actually Hear the Reference, Click the Speaker Icon
